-/*
- * Base for ring buffer users
- */
-class MRequestBufferBookKeepingBase
-    {
-public:
-    virtual TUint32 GetWriteCount() = 0;
-    virtual TUint32 GetReadCount() = 0;
-    virtual TUint32 BufferTail() = 0;
-    };
-
-/*
- * Ring buffer writer. Data source for ring buffer.
- */
-class MRequestBufferBookKeepingWriter: public MRequestBufferBookKeepingBase
-    {
-public:
-    virtual TUint32 BufferHead() = 0;
-    virtual void SetBufferHead( TUint32 aIndex ) = 0;
-    virtual void IncrementWriteCount( TUint32 aWriteCount ) = 0;
-    virtual void SetMaxTailIndex( TUint32 aIndex ) = 0;
-    };
-
-/*
- * Ring buffer reader. Data consumer for ring buffer.
- */
-class MRequestBufferBookKeepingReader: public MRequestBufferBookKeepingBase
-    {
-public:
-    virtual void SetBufferTail( TUint32 aIndex ) = 0;
-    virtual void IncrementReadCount( TUint32 aReadCount ) = 0;
-    virtual TUint32 MaxTailIndex() = 0;
-    };
-
-class RequestBufferBase
-    {
-public:
-
-    /*
-     * 
-     */
-    static TUint32 AdjustAlignment( TUint32 aIndex, const TUint32 aAlignment )
-    {
-    const TUint32 remainder = aIndex % aAlignment;
-    if ( remainder )
-        {
-        aIndex += aAlignment - remainder;
-        }
-    return aIndex;
-    }
-        
-protected:
-
-    /*
-     * 
-     */
-    RequestBufferBase( TUint32 aSize ):
-        iSize( aSize )
-        {}
-    
-protected:
-    const TUint32 iSize;
-    };
-
-
-
-class RequestBufferWriter: RequestBufferBase
-    {
-public:
-
-    /*
-     * 
-     */
-    RequestBufferWriter( MRequestBufferBookKeepingWriter& aBookKeeper, TUint32 aSize ): 
-        RequestBufferBase( aSize ),
-        iBookKeeper( aBookKeeper )
-        {}
-    
-    /*
-     * 
-     */
-    void InitBuffer()
-        {
-        iBookKeeper.SetBufferHead( 0 );    
-        iBookKeeper.SetMaxTailIndex( iSize );
-        }
-    
-    /*
-     * Does not check for free space, assure free space by using CheckForSpace
-     */
-    TUint32 AllocateBytes( const TUint32 aBytes )
-        {
-        TUint32 base = iBookKeeper.BufferHead();
-        if ( base + aBytes > iSize )
-            {
-            iBookKeeper.SetMaxTailIndex( base );
-            base = 0;
-            }
-        else if ( iBookKeeper.BufferTail() <= base )
-            {
-            iBookKeeper.SetMaxTailIndex( iSize );
-            }
-        return base;
-        }
-
-    /*
-     * Does not check for free space, assure free space by using CheckForSpace
-     */
-    void CommitBytes( const TUint32 aBase, const TUint32 aBytes )
-        {
-        //TUint32 base = CheckIndexForWrapAround( AdjustAlignment( aBase + aBytes, 4 ) );
-        TUint32 base = AdjustAlignment( aBase + aBytes, 4 );
-		const TUint32 inc( base - aBase );
-        iBookKeeper.SetBufferHead( base );
-        iBookKeeper.IncrementWriteCount( inc );
-        }
-
-    /*
-     * 
-     */
-    TBool CheckForSpace( const TUint32 aSpaceNeeded )
-        {
-        const TUint32 inputBufferHead( iBookKeeper.BufferHead() );
-        const TUint32 inputBufferTail( iBookKeeper.BufferTail() );
-        //Notice that tail might grow during the execution of this function
-        // but it would only cause false negative as a result
-
-        //Buffer can be empty or full
-        if ( inputBufferHead == inputBufferTail )
-            {
-            //Check if the buffer is full or empty
-            if ( iBookKeeper.GetWriteCount() - iBookKeeper.GetReadCount() )
-                {
-                //Buffer is full
-                return EFalse;
-                }
-            }
-
-        //Let's check if the SFC fits to the buffer
-        const TUint32 newHeadIndex = inputBufferHead + aSpaceNeeded;// + alignmentAdjust;
-
-        if ( inputBufferHead < inputBufferTail && newHeadIndex > inputBufferTail )
-            {
-            //Buffer does not have enough space
-            return EFalse; 
-            }
-        else if ( inputBufferHead >= inputBufferTail )
-            {
-            if ( newHeadIndex > iSize && aSpaceNeeded > inputBufferTail )
-                {
-                //Buffer does not have enough space
-                return EFalse;
-                }
-            }
-        return ETrue;        
-        }
-    
-private:
-    MRequestBufferBookKeepingWriter& iBookKeeper;
-    };
-
-class RequestBufferReader: public RequestBufferBase
-    {
-public:
-    /*
-     * 
-     */
-    RequestBufferReader( MRequestBufferBookKeepingReader& aBookKeeper, TUint32 aSize ): 
-        RequestBufferBase( aSize ),
-        iBookKeeper( aBookKeeper )
-        {}
-    
-    /*
-     * 
-     */
-    void InitBuffer()
-        {
-        iBookKeeper.SetBufferTail( 0 );
-        }
-    
-    /*
-     * 
-     */
-    TUint32 GetReadIndex()
-        {
-		const TUint32 bufTail( iBookKeeper.BufferTail() );
-		const TUint32 bufTail2( CheckIndexForWrapAround( bufTail ) );
-        if ( bufTail != bufTail2 )
-			{
-			iBookKeeper.SetBufferTail( bufTail2 );
-			}
-		return bufTail2;
-        }
-    
-    /*
-     * 
-     */
-    void FreeBytes( TUint32 aBytes )
-        {
-		const TUint32 oldTail(iBookKeeper.BufferTail());
-        TUint32 newBufferTail = AdjustAlignment( aBytes + oldTail, 4 );
-		const TUint32 inc( newBufferTail - oldTail );
-        newBufferTail = CheckIndexForWrapAround( newBufferTail );
-        iBookKeeper.IncrementReadCount( inc );
-        iBookKeeper.SetBufferTail( newBufferTail );
-        }
-
-    /*
-     * 
-     */
-    TBool IsDataAvailable()
-        {
-		const TUint32 readc( iBookKeeper.GetReadCount() );
-		const TUint32 writec( iBookKeeper.GetWriteCount() );
-        return readc != writec;
-        }   
-    
-    /*
-     * 
-     */
-    TUint32 CheckIndexForWrapAround( TUint32 aIndex )
-        {
-        //Head is behind of tail when MaxTailIndex is applied so
-        // this routine works for head, too
-        if ( aIndex >= iBookKeeper.MaxTailIndex() )
-            {
-            return 0;
-            }
-        return aIndex;
-        }
-
-private:
-    MRequestBufferBookKeepingReader& iBookKeeper;
-    };
